Why Manual Harvesting is Still Relevant
In an era where technology is rapidly changing how industries operate, manual sod harvesting remains essential for several reasons. Some landscapes, especially those on uneven terrain or in tight spaces, cannot be effectively served by large machinery. These areas require the careful touch and adaptability that only skilled labor can provide. Furthermore, in residential landscaping, where custom solutions are in high demand, manual harvesting allows for a closer inspection of the soil and existing vegetation, ensuring that sod placement is optimal. Professionals must embrace manual methods to ensure the quality and integrity of their work. While manual harvesting is laborious, its relevance cannot be understated, especially when it comes to fulfilling specific landscape needs.
Technological Innovations: The Game Changers
Despite the enduring need for manual methods, technological innovations are beginning to make waves in the sod industry. Automated sod cutters and harvesters are emerging, allowing professionals to increase productivity and reduce physical strain. These advanced machines are designed with features that enhance efficiency and offer precision that manual methods may lack, representing a significant shift in how landscape technicians can approach their tasks.
For instance, innovations such as GPS-guided sod cutters enable users to work with greater accuracy, which minimizes waste and improves overall landscape aesthetics. Additionally, battery-powered tools are reducing not only physical exertion but also the noise pollution often associated with gas-powered equipment. As technology continues to evolve, we can expect more robust solutions that will change the landscape maintenance paradigm.
The Physical Toll and Safety Concerns
As highlighted in the video, manual sod harvesting takes a toll on physical health. Prolonged bending and lifting can lead to injuries, making safety a priority. Lawncare professionals must be informed about ergonomics and training to mitigate these risks. The use of appropriate equipment, proper techniques, and regular breaks can significantly reduce the risk of injury, enabling workers to perform their jobs effectively and sustainably over time.
Moreover, industry professionals should consider utilizing tools designed to minimize strain. Items such as kneepads, ergonomic shovels, and even back support belts can reduce the physical toll of harvesting sod. By prioritizing health and safety measures, companies can nurture a more sustainable workforce by reducing worker’s compensation claims and ensuring that their teams remain healthy and engaged for longer durations.
